๐ 1. Overview Reed Flute Cave, located in Guilin, Guangxi Province, is one of Chinaโs most famous natural attractions. Known for its breathtaking limestone formations, the cave is often referred to as โthe Palace of Natural Artโ due to its stunning stalactites, stalagmites, and other unique rock formations. The cave stretches over 500 meters and is illuminated with colorful lights, creating a magical atmosphere that showcases the natural beauty of the region. It is named after the reeds that grow outside the cave, which were once used to make flutes.

๐บ๏ธ 3. Sub-Zones in Reed Flute Cave
Sub-Zone | What to Expect |
---|---|
Main Cave Chamber | The largest and most impressive area of the cave, featuring the most intricate rock formations. |
The Crystal Palace | A part of the cave where the stalactites and stalagmites appear like shimmering crystals. |
The Dragon Head | A prominent rock formation that resembles a dragonโs head, one of the cave’s signature sights. |
The Lion and Elephant | Famous formations shaped like a lion and an elephant, offering great photo opportunities. |
The Pagoda | A formation that resembles an ancient pagoda, symbolizing harmony and peace. |
